tombac (alloy) (brass (alloy), copper alloy, ... Materials (hierarchy name)) |
|
Note: An alloy of a brassy nature generally containing 85 to 88% copper and 12 to 15% zinc, and sometimes arsenic; used for coins, buttons, jewelry, and gilding. |
